In preparation for this event, at least once a day, I completed a picture in <20minutes. Below you can see the results~

(Most recent first!)

Day 3

time: 20min

I decided to retry the idea from day 2. Personally I’m MUCH happier with this outcome!

Next time I want to develop more contrast in the center. And possibly get rid of the house…

Day 2

time: 20min

Definitely went in with an idea for what I wanted… The execution was less than ideal. I got caught up in the details too early and didn’t pay enough attention to composition.

I am happy with how efficient it was using a sponge with acrylics and water colors! But I need to make sure I’m not drenching my canvas right away and pay attention to composition and shapes overall…

Remember what I really want to be part of the picture and what can be left alone/obscure.

Day 1

time: 19min

First day of prep!

I didn’t really go in with any kind of ideas. There was a lot of colors used here- probably going to try to work on a dryer canvas next time.

Also going to experiment with sketching out figures or scenes really quickly in the beginning
